My students are diverse learners looking for new opportunities to read books that capture their imagination and make them eager to continue reading. I want to provide my students with a welcoming and comfy reading corner to enjoy reading in. As a first year teacher I don't have the classroom library that my students deserve to thrive and promote a love for reading. I hope to use non fiction books such as The Name Jar and Martin's Big words The Life of Dr. Martin Luther King Jr. to promote empathy and understanding to diverse backgrounds. I want to use fiction books such as The Magic Tree House and Mystery A to Z books to promote a sense of curiosity and a love of reading.
